Sine Tangent Cosine In addition to the LaSalle mathematical curriculunn — algebra, high school math, geometry, trigonometry, and advanced courses for the college-bound student, such as calculus and analytical geometry — something new has been added. Nine new computers have been obtained to assist in the teaching and learning of mathematics. The math teachers were encouraged to use the computers as a supplementary aid in their courses of study. The computer programming class, taught by Mr. Myers, enabled the stu- dents to write programs for mathematical — type problems. Also, exit tests will be introduced this spring to determine future placement. Those unsuccessful students will be channeled into assurance classes. 68
